What are Ziegler Rugs?

Handmade Ziegler rugs for sale, are also known as Chobi rugs or Peshawar rugs, are the peak of beauty in the Western world.

Sultanabad's design impacted the design of Ziegler carpets. It does, however, come in more subdued tones and muted hues that work well in both contemporary and classic settings.

These rugs were first woven in the Arak area of Iran, but they are currently produced in numerous countries across the Persian region. For instance, you may find this design among Pakistani rugs for sale, Afghani rugs, or rugs exported by other rug manufacturing countries.

The majority of new Ziegler designs are labeled Chobi and made in Afghanistan.

These subtle-hues rugs with intricate floral patterns and a captivating charm come from Persia, masterfully designed by German designers, and were shipped to Europe and America around 1883. It wasn’t long before the masterpieces gained immense popularity and were being produced in numerous Asian countries for export.

These soft carpets continued to prosper throughout the 20th century, in part because of their complimenting lifestyles of leisure interior design. Their antique rugs share a similar design to that of Mahal.

Ziegler rugs, like Khal Mohammadi rugs, have reintroduced vegetable colors into Persian and Oriental weaving after the widespread usage of chemical dyes since the early twentieth century.

The hand-spun Ghazni wool or Himalayan wool used is of great quality, and the structure is highly robust, despite the low knot count.

Due to their neutral and soothing tones, as well as softer designs, the charming Ziegler rugs for sale are arguably the most popular and sought-after handmade carpets in the UK; there aren't many spaces that wouldn't benefit from one.
